服务器脚本语言:揭秘幕后编程的世界131
服务器脚本语言是幕后运行的神秘力量,让我们的网站和在线应用程序得以运作。了解这些语言如何发挥作用至关重要,以便更有效地开发和维护您的 Web 应用程序。
服务器脚本语言的定义:
服务器脚本语言是一种计算机语言,它在 Web 服务器上执行,而不是在客户端(即用户浏览器)上。这些语言允许服务器动态生成 Web 页面和响应用户请求,从而为您提供交互式、个性化的 Web 体验。
服务器脚本语言的工作原理:
当您访问一个需要服务器端处理的 Web 页面时,您的浏览器会向 Web 服务器发送一个请求。服务器接收请求后,它会执行该页面中包含的服务器脚本。脚本通常包含数据库访问、用户输入处理、会话管理或动态内容生成等代码。
脚本执行完成后,生成的结果将发送回您的浏览器并显示在您的屏幕上。这是一种无缝的过程,使您可以与 Web 服务器进行交互而无需意识到底层处理。
常用的服务器脚本语言:
有许多不同的服务器脚本语言可用,每种语言都有自己的优势和劣势。以下是业界最流行的一些语言:
PHP(超文本预处理器):最广泛使用的服务器脚本语言,以其易学、开源和广泛的社区支持而闻名。
Python:一种通用的高级语言,以其可读性、灵活性以及适用于广泛应用程序领域的丰富库而著称。
Java:一种平台无关的语言,适用于各种 Web 应用程序,包括企业级解决方案和复杂的后端系统。
:一个建立在 JavaScript 之上的服务器端平台,以其异步编程模型和实时功能而闻名。
Ruby on Rails:一个基于 Ruby 语言的 Web 应用程序框架,以其快速开发、约定优于配置以及强大的社区支持而闻名。
选择服务器脚本语言时要考虑的因素:
选择最适合您项目的服务器脚本语言时,需要考虑以下因素:
开发团队技能:团队是否熟悉特定语言或愿意学习新语言?
应用程序需求:应用程序的复杂性、性能和可扩展性要求是什么?
生态系统和支持:该语言是否有活跃的社区、丰富的库和文档?
成本和许可证:该语言的使用是否需要付费许可证或开源?
了解服务器脚本语言对于构建动态且响应迅速的 Web 应用程序至关重要。通过明智地选择语言并有效地使用它,开发人员可以创建高效且用户友好的 Web 体验。随着 Web 技术的不断发展,服务器脚本语言将继续扮演着至关重要的角色,为我们的在线世界提供动力。
2024-11-27

Perl语言发音及语言特性详解
https://jb123.cn/perl/45832.html

Perl高效Ping循环及网络监控脚本编写详解
https://jb123.cn/perl/45831.html

编程脚本剪辑模板图片免费下载与高效使用指南
https://jb123.cn/jiaobenbiancheng/45830.html

弱类型动态脚本语言:灵活与挑战并存的编程世界
https://jb123.cn/jiaobenyuyan/45829.html

大数据网页脚本编程:高效采集与处理的利器
https://jb123.cn/jiaobenbiancheng/45828.html
热门文章

脚本语言:让计算机自动化执行任务的秘密武器
https://jb123.cn/jiaobenyuyan/6564.html

快速掌握产品脚本语言,提升产品力
https://jb123.cn/jiaobenyuyan/4094.html

Tcl 脚本语言项目
https://jb123.cn/jiaobenyuyan/25789.html

脚本语言的力量:自动化、效率提升和创新
https://jb123.cn/jiaobenyuyan/25712.html

PHP脚本语言在网站开发中的广泛应用
https://jb123.cn/jiaobenyuyan/20786.html